"Rails don't go to every department store or grocery store" Bit of a self fullfilling prophecy there. Lots of places around the world have rail slips going to the back of shopping malls. The real reason is that 100 years ago the rail companies in America were so predatory and vicious to any customer trying to ship something smaller than a boxar's worth that the first generation of truck drivers were pretty much heroes for providing an alternative. The companies decided to stay in an inwardly looking economic niche and pretty much only ship slow moving multicar loads. |
